如果在这样的结构中 我们在Controller中注入,但我们后续需要修改Oss时,比如从minioService改成AliyunService时,需要改动的代码很多。于是我们抽象出一个FileService,让controller只跟fileservice耦合,这样我没只需要在…
2025/1/30 12:34:291 安装依赖 yum -y install gcc zlib zlib-devel pcre-devel openssl openssl-devel2 下载Nginx wget http://nginx.org/download/nginx-1.21.3.tar.gz3 安装目录 mkdir -p /data/apps/nginx4 安装 4.1 创建用户 创建用户nginx使用的nginx用户。 #添加www组 # groupa…
2025/1/16 23:43:33准备工作 需求 & 环境搭建 需求说明 环境搭建 步骤: 准备数据库表(dept、emp)创建 springboot 工程,引入对应的起步依赖(web、mybatis、mysql 驱动、lombok)配置文件 application.properties 中引入 mybatis 的配置信息&…
2025/1/28 20:06:32最近在项目中遇到了 OCR 的需求,希望能够实现高效而准确的文字识别。由于预算限制,我并未选择商业付费方案,而是优先尝试了开源工具。一开始,我测试了 GOT-OCR2.0,但由于我的 Mac 配置较低,不支持 GPU 运算…
2025/1/25 7:34:17题目链接https://www.acwing.com/problem/content/3374/ 分析 : 新加入的一头奶牛A,则我们每次只需要判断与A相邻的4头牛和A这头牛 舒适的牛数量增加的情况:五头牛中的任意一头牛与其相邻的牛的数量为3 舒适的牛数量减少的情况:除…
2025/1/30 12:38:11 人评论 次浏览W25Q128(W25Q系列SPI Flahs和W25X系列的SPI Flash)驱动,使用句柄方式,分离底层,便于移植。 编写一些应用代码,将底层与实际应用进行分离,方便移植使用,具体思路就是讲所需的全局变量࿰…
2025/1/30 12:21:57 人评论 次浏览/* arguments 对象 ECMAScript 函数不介意传递进来多少参数,也不会因为参数不统一而错误。 实际上,函数体内可以通过 arguments 对象来接收传递进来的参数。 */function box(){ return arguments[0] | arguments[1]; //得到每次参数的值 ,1 …
2025/1/30 11:26:07 人评论 次浏览题库来源:安全生产模拟考试一点通公众号小程序 2020年美容师(初级)考试报名及美容师(初级)考试试卷,包含美容师(初级)考试报名答案和解析及美容师(初级)考试…
2025/1/30 11:01:47 人评论 次浏览ADC 知识整理 一、ADC的类型: 积分型逐次逼近型并行比较/串型比较型Σ-Δ调制型电容阵列逐次比较型压频变换型 (Voltage-Frequency Converter) 二、ADC的主要技术指标: 分辩率(Resolution)转换速率(Conversion Rate)量化误差 (Quantizing Error)偏移误…
2025/1/30 13:27:55 人评论 次浏览最近有个MOSS的项目,以前虽然有接触过,但无非就是一些关于MOSS的使用等,真正的二次开发没有做过,因为这个项目只能拼命啃了,网上相关的资料其实很多,但是要找到自己想要的比较困难.好了,直接进入正题.... 原来是想用Infopath来做表单的,但是因为客户需要的表单比较复杂,Infopat…
2025/1/30 13:27:25 人评论 次浏览场景: 源端有100多个表空间,目标端,导入数据的时候,要建立这么多表空间,或者要remap_tablespace,要写100多个。很麻烦,使用transform参数,可以解决这个问题。 RDBMS 19.15 help中关于transfor…
2025/1/30 13:26:55 人评论 次浏览Log4J的配置文件(Configuration File)就是用来设置记录器的级别、存放器和布局的,它可接keyvalue格式的设置或xml格式的设置信息。通过配置,可以创建出Log4J的运行环境。 1. 配置文件Log4J配置文件的基本格式如下: #配置根Logger log4j.root…
2025/1/30 13:26:24 人评论 次浏览启动程序时报错:java.lang.IllegalStateException: Error processing condition on org.springframework.boot.autoconfigure.context.PropertyPlaceholderAutoConfiguration.propertySourcesPlaceholderConfigurer 清除缓存并重启后好了。
2025/1/30 13:25:54 人评论 次浏览作者:Walker 在机器学习的世界中,通常我们会发现有很多问题并没有最优的解,或是要计算出最优的解要花费很大的计算量,面对这类问题一般的做法是利用迭代的思想尽可能的逼近问题的最优解。我们把解决此类优化问题的方法叫做优化算法…
2025/1/30 13:25:23 人评论 次浏览在某些特殊情况下,我们的 Python 脚本需要调用父目录下的其他模块。例如:在编写 GNE 的测试用例时,有一个脚本 generate_new_cases.py放在 tests文件夹中。而 tests 文件夹与 gne 文件夹放在同一个位置。其中 gne 文件夹是一个包。我现在需要…
2025/1/29 8:16:43 人评论 次浏览一.beacon帧主要结构 二.MAC header 1.Version:版本号,目前为止802.11只有一个版本,所以协议编号为0 2.Type:定义802.11帧类型,802.11帧分为管理帧(00),控…
2025/1/29 8:19:05 人评论 次浏览我最近在一个动态壁纸应用程序工作。在这我发现我的Android动态壁纸有一个奇怪的问题。我使用我的HTC野火S,三星银河标签,摩托罗拉Droid磨石,三星银河流行音乐测试我的壁纸与模拟器一起工作正常,但在三星手机(三星Galaxy S II和三…
2025/1/29 14:08:50 人评论 次浏览一、题目描述 所有异常,全部在调用方法内捕获处理 将以下IOTest类的全部方法实现 public class IOTest { public static void main(String[] args) { String fileName “C:/example/from.txt”; System.out.println("----- 创建文件 ------");createFi…
2025/1/29 7:57:59 人评论 次浏览为了实现文件的安全、高速存储,单位购置了一台文件服务器,内置RAID卡和五块热插拔硬盘。可是,RAID卡的设置谁也没有见过,连操作系统都装不上。这可怎么办呢? 对于文件存储、视频点播等服务器而言,不仅数…
2025/1/27 17:22:27 人评论 次浏览1. GitHub 上创建仓库 在 GitHub 页面中 new 一个仓库,仓库名建议和本地文件夹名称保持一致 2. 初始化本地仓库 打开自己的项目文件夹,右键》Git Bash Here,可以快速定位到本地仓库。用命令初始化 Git 仓库 $ git init -b main-b main 表…
2025/1/29 8:13:11 人评论 次浏览